About Pine Street
Pine Street in Timmins, Ontario, is a well-established residential area with a mix of single-family homes and multi-unit buildings. The neighborhood offers a blend of urban convenience and natural beauty, with easy access to schools, parks, shopping centers, and cultural landmarks. Timmins is known for its rich mining history and vibrant community life, making Pine Street a desirable location for families and professionals alike.
